What do you observed when hot concentrated caustic soda solution is added to zinc and aluminum?

a) Zinc react with hot conc. caustic soda or hot conc. sodium hydroxide to produce zincate sodium and hydrogen.

Zn+2NaOH→Na2ZnO2+H2

b) Aluminum react with sodium hydroxide to produce sodium aluminate, hydrogen and sodium oxide.
2Al + 6NaOH ----->2NaAlO2 + 3H2 + 2Na2O
